I'm glad someone brought this up, even if it is in a slightly different context, because this contract is puzzling to me. Watkins signed a deal that will basically guarantee him $9m, but it also has incentives that can push it to almost $16m. Most of the targets are pretty obtainable. If he plays 14 games and goes for 65-800-8, he'll earn half of his incentives right there and earn around $12. That's in the range of salaries of such players as DeAndre Hopkins, Adam Thielen, Keenan Allen, and Amari Cooper. He has the best pure QB in the game, and he's not even the #1 guy on his team!

He should have been cut instead of the restructure, imo.
